RobbJack NAB ultra-precision saw arbor with clamping nut, spacers, and flange

Ultra-precision saw arbors with 15x the gripping force of screw-cap designs — every size available in a thru-coolant (-TC) version that floods the cut through solid carbide CF flanges.

  • 15x gripping force — nut-clamped design grips the saw far harder than screw-cap arbors, solving slippage in high-torque cuts
  • Eight sizes from 1/4" to 1-1/4" arbor diameter (NAB-250 through NAB-1250), each also available as a -TC thru-coolant version
  • Published clamp-nut torque specs per size: NAB-250 96 in-lb, NAB-375 300 in-lb, NAB-500 and NAB-625 540 in-lb, NAB-750 through NAB-1250 600 in-lb
  • Spacer sets included with every arbor (.0625"/.125"/.1875" on 1/4" and 3/8"; .0625"/.1875"/.25" on 1/2" and up)
  • Removable keyway drive, available upon request: 1/8" key on 5/8"-7/8" sizes, 1/4" on 1", 5/16" on 1-1/4" (1/4"-1/2" sizes have no standard keyway)
  • Tightest tolerances in the industry: arbor size -.0001"/-.0003", shank diameter -.0001"/-.0004", runout .0005" max — RobbJack arbors hold less than .0002" runout assembled
  • CF solid carbide thru-coolant flanges are required (sold in pairs) when running the -TC thru-coolant versions

About this series

NAB Ultra-Precision Saw Arbors

The tightest-tolerance saw arbors in the industry

RobbJack NAB saw arbors are ultra-precision arbors for carbide slitting saws, ground to the tightest tolerances in the industry to solve many of the problems associated with using carbide slitting saws. They hold less than .0002" runout and are available in standard and Thru-Coolant (-TC) versions. Thru-Coolant versions require CF Thru-Coolant Flanges, and when ganging multiple saws also require CSP Thru-Coolant Spacers.

  • Less than .0002" runout
  • Tightest tolerances in the industry
  • Standard and Thru-Coolant (-TC) versions
  • Removable keyway available upon request as a special
  • Spacers included (.0625", .125", .1875" / .25")
  • Published torque specs for each size

Sizes 1/4" through 1-1/4". Thru-Coolant (-TC) versions require CF Thru-Coolant Flanges; CSP Thru-Coolant Spacers needed when ganging multiple saws.
